Just a few days ago Vince Gill made a $12,000 donation to the Oklahoma Music Hall of Fame. His kindness is to help finish construction on a brand new children’s music exhibit.

Gill has been a member of the Oklahoma Music Hall of Fame since 1999, and a member of the Country Music Hall of Fame since 2007, and has challenged other musicians and singers to pitch in and donate to the cause.

The children’s exhibit is almost complete, but they’re still a little bit shy of what they need to finish. When finished,the project will be open to children of all ages and hosted by Jeremiah the Bullfrog.You know him from Three Dog Night’s hit ‘Joy to the World,’ which was written by Oklahoma native Hoyt Axton.

And something else you might find interesting, Hoyt Axton’s mother, Mae Axton, wrote ‘Heartbreak Hotel’ which was recorded by Elvis Presley.

In the exhibit, children can build a band, observe the different sounds of different musical instruments and learn about Oklahoma’s many contributions to music.

The Executive Director from the Oklahoma Music Hall of Fame said, “We can’t thank Mr. Gill enough for his generosity, and we are honored that he would also step forward to issue a challenge to his fellow inductees to make a contribution … We believe children need to understand that music comes from real people and real musical instruments not just from electronics.”
